Welcome to Answerpool. First off have you got an error code Number returned?
quote:
452: Rate limiting due to aberrantly high volume of incoming mail
455: Recipient's mailbox is full
550: Recipient is an invalid email address (user unknown)
551: Server or domain manually blocked
553: Server is an open relay
554: Server blocked due to spam complaints
555: Recipient's mailbox is full
556: Server is an open proxy
